    public GameObject fireSpread(Vector2 goalPos)
    {
        GameObject target    = null;
        float      minDist   = 0;
        bool       minStatus = true;

        foreach (GameObject creep in GameObject.FindGameObjectsWithTag("Creep"))
        {
            float creepDist = Mathf.Pow((creep.transform.position.x - this.transform.position.x), 2.0f) + Mathf.Pow((creep.transform.position.z - this.transform.position.z), 2.0f);
            if (creepDist < (Mathf.Pow(range, 2)))
            {
                float targetDist = Mathf.Pow((creep.transform.position.x - goalPos.x), 2.0f) + Mathf.Pow((creep.transform.position.z - goalPos.y), 2.0f);
                creep c          = (creep)creep.GetComponent("creep");
                bool  hasStatus  = false;
                for (int i = 1; i < c.currentStatuses.Length; i++)
                {
                    if (c.currentStatuses[i] > 0)
                    {
                        hasStatus = true;
                        break;
                    }
                }
                //we assign a new target if it is closer to the goal or we don't have a target yet
                if ((minStatus && !hasStatus) || ((minStatus || (!minStatus && !hasStatus)) && (targetDist < minDist)) || minDist == 0)
                {
                    target    = creep;
                    minDist   = targetDist;
                    minStatus = hasStatus;
                }
            }
        }
        return(target);
    }

    public GameObject fireStrong()
    {
        GameObject target    = null;
        float      maxHealth = 0;

        foreach (GameObject creep in GameObject.FindGameObjectsWithTag("Creep"))
        {
            float creepDist = Mathf.Pow((creep.transform.position.x - this.transform.position.x), 2.0f) + Mathf.Pow((creep.transform.position.z - this.transform.position.z), 2.0f);
            if (creepDist < (Mathf.Pow(range, 2)))
            {
                creep c            = (creep)creep.GetComponent("creep");
                float targetHealth = c.health;
                //we assign a new target if it is closer to the goal or we don't have a target yet
                if ((targetHealth > maxHealth) || maxHealth == 0)
                {
                    target    = creep;
                    maxHealth = targetHealth;
                }
            }
        }
        return(target);
    }
